La identificacion de cada tipo celular se realizo mediante la tecnica inmunocitoquimica de la pap en cortes en parafina para el estudio estructural y la superimposicion de cortes semifinos inmunomarcados adyacentes a cortes ultrafinos para su identificacion ultraestructural.  las celulas gh no sufren variaciones y segun el tama\u00f1o de sus granulos hemos diferenciado 4 tipos. Las celulas son de dos tipos pas positivas y pas negativas  estas ultimas aumentan en numero durante la gestacion y produccion lactea  con un mayor desarrollo de las citomembranas mas manifiesto en la ultima fase. Las celulas acth con dos tipos de granulos aumentan en gestacion donde presentan grandes vacuolas no inmunote\u00f1idas que regresan en lactacion. Hemos identificado tres tipos morfologicos de celulas gonadotropas que se corresponden con distintos aspectos funcionales de un mismo tipo celular  aumentan en numero y actividad en gestacion.
